    I'm returning my triple blade cutters again because they broke. Called CubanCrafters.com to see if I could just get store credit and they said that was fine. So I got home last night and started looking around their site to see what I wanted. I clicked on stores for some reason and saw that there was one in West Point, MS which is about 45 min - 1 hour away from here. Me and Sarah were gonna hang out but had no plans at all, so I called her to see if she wanted to go with me. She agreed. So off we went, I smoked a Padron 2k that I got from a trade with C Juan (i think) on the way down. Very good cigar. We find it and it's this little shop that looks just like a small gas station. I didn't have a good feeling. I walk in and I see a walk-in in the back and another display case beside it. Feeling Better. I walk in and there's a group of guys sitting down and a guy asks if there's anything I'm looking for. I've been thinking about getting another box of the DK Browns so I asked if he carried any. He did and he showed me where they were. And so begins the start of an amazing friendship.

    We just start talking cigars. I mean, really talking cigars. I did not know how much information I had retained because I had never talked cigars with someone in person. But man, I was spittin' out facts and background information like you wouldn't believe ... heck, like I wouldn't believe. I hope Sarah was impressed. Anyways, I was having a blast. He starts giving me free cigars and giving me some suggestions to try. By this point, I was silly with excitement. He even picked out some smokes for Sarah. He giftet her a RP Vintage 99 Connecticut and I got her a tin of Carlos Torano Exodus 1959. Right before we left he asked if I had ever had a VSG. We had been talking about them earlier, and I replied that I had not. He said grab one. I said no. He said, 'No it's on the house'. I said, 'That's a freaking $10 stick and I'm not taking it'. So he grabbed it and gave it to Sarah, I told her I was gonna make her smoke it on the way home. We went to the counter to check out and I notice he was just looking at the cigars and typing in prices, I said "I don't see how you remember all those prices," He replied, "I don't I'm marking them down lower than I know they are." Then threw in a nice double-bladed cutter and the newest CA magazine. I think we spent about 2 hours in there and he stayed in there an extra 30 minutes after he closed just to talk. Walked out only paying $40 even. Insane! The tins alone were suppose to be $10.
